Dr. Dacques C. Pourciau

Pets: Izzy, Nubs, Raymond, Bob, Pepper Bowtie, Skunk, Mrs. Ronnie, Cheddar, Gouda, Mr. Brown, Bullseye, Junie, and Dally

Graduating from LSU School of Veterinary Medicine in 2004, Dr. Dacques completed his preceptorship at the famous 6666 Ranch in Guthrie, Texas afterward. From there he began his career in Carencro where he worked as a veterinarian at Evangeline Downs. In 2005, he was offered a position at the Center Ranch in Centerville, Texas. During his tenure there, he was able to advance his knowledge of equine reproductive work and lameness.

In 2010, he and his family moved to his wife's hometown of Maurice. They opened Maurice Veterinary Clinic in March of 2011 and have been Building Friendships, One Pet at a Time ever since. Dr. Dac and Neysa have three children: Beau, Everett, and Aliegh. They have seven horses, two dogs, and many cats! In his spare time, he loves cooking and spending time with his family and friends.

Dr. Holland Gaines

Pets :  Athena, Willow, Chewie, and Penne

Dr. Gaines graduated from LSU School of Veterinary Medicine in 2005. After graduation, she completed a Small Animal Internship in Atlanta, GA. For 6 years, she was an associate veterinarian in a small animal practice in Florida before relocating back to Louisiana in 2012. Dr. Holly and her husband wanted to get back to their roots and get closer to family here in Louisiana. She has been a practicing small animal veterinarian in Lafayette and surrounding areas over the past four years. Dr. Holly enjoys all aspects of veterinary medicine but has a special interest in surgery, ultrasound, and internal medicine/oncology.

Dr. Holly and her husband Brad have two daughters Ava and Mya. In her spare time, she spends time with her family. At home she has two cats and two dogs. She is very excited about the future and looks forward to getting to know you and caring for your pets.
